Wheel Rotation Service
Regular tire maintenance is essential for car safety and performance, and tire rotation is a key service provided by mobile tire technicians. Tire rotation involves regularly adjusting the position of each tire to promote even tread wear, extending tire lifespan and enhancing handling. Uneven wear can result in reduced traction, affecting vehicle control and safety. Mobile tire services provide the convenience of performing this vital task at a location of the customer's choice, eliminating the need for a trip to a garage. Technicians typically recommend rotating tires every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, depending on vehicle type and driving conditions. By addressing tire rotation proactively, drivers can ensure peak performance and decrease the risk of premature tire replacement.
Valve Stem Installation
A notable amount of automobile owners might ignore the importance of valve stem care, yet these minor components are important for tire health. Valve stems hold air inside the tire, and a defective stem can cause minor leaks and decreased tire pressure. Over time, constant exposure to heat, moisture, and debris from the road can result in deterioration, creating potential safety risks. Mobile tire services offer valve stem replacement as a easy fix, enabling drivers to fix it promptly. Technicians can rapidly assess and replace damaged stems right at the location, providing optimal tire performance and safety. By emphasizing valve stem upkeep, vehicle owners can extend their tires' lifespan and avoid unexpected breakdowns.

Routine Pressure Assessments
Although many operators ignore tire pressure, routine checks are vital for optimal vehicle performance and well-being. Keeping the correct tire pressure helps boost fuel economy and ensures superior control. Drivers should inspect their tire pressure at least once a month and before distant trips, as variable temperatures can impact it. Using a trustworthy tire pressure meter, they can easily assess if modifications are necessary. Correctly inflated tires minimize deterioration, extending their lifespan and improving overall driving comfort. Additionally, sustaining the proper pressure reduces the chance of tire failures and other tire-related incidents. To sum up, adding routine pressure checks into car upkeep routines can significantly lead to more secure driving situations and enhanced vehicle performance.
Track Tread Depth
Consistently inspecting tread depth is necessary for supporting tire safety and performance. Tires with reduced tread can contribute to limited traction, notably in wet conditions, amplifying the risk of accidents. An uncomplicated way to evaluate tread depth is by applying the penny test: insert a penny into the tread groove; if Lincoln's head is visible, the tread is too worn and swapping is necessary. Moreover, many service stations deliver tread depth gauges for a more precise measurement. Keeping adequate tread depth not only boosts safety but also increases fuel efficiency. Regular inspections, ideally every month or before long trips, can help drivers stay aware of their tire condition, creating a safer driving experience overall.
Precise Wheel Alignment
Ensuring proper wheel alignment can significantly improve tire lifespan and driving performance. Misalignment often leads to uneven tire wear, reducing their lifespan and requiring more regular tire changes. Regular checks, preferably at 6,000 mile intervals or during tire rotations, can assist in detecting alignment issues early. Signs of misalignment include a tugging sensation while driving, inconsistent tire tread degradation, or a crooked steering wheel. Correct alignment guarantees that all tires make consistent contact with the road, improving handling and fuel efficiency. Additionally, maintaining the correct tire pressure complements alignment efforts, additionally improving performance. What Is the Best Way to prepare My Vehicle for a Mobile Tire Service?
To prepare for a mobile tire service, one should ensure the vehicle is positioned on a flat surface, remove any hubcaps or wheel covers, and keep the owner's manual accessible for reference during the service.
